The UAntwerp Solar Boat Team is a group of Bachelor’s and Master’s students from the Faculty of Applied Engineering at the University of Antwerp. Each year, the team designs and builds a solar-powered racing boat to compete in international competitions, a demanding environment that pushes its members to innovate in efficient, sustainable energy use. In recent years, the team has focused strongly on autonomous sailing: by developing a fully electronic steer-by-wire system, AI-powered object detection and intelligent pathfinding algorithms, supported by a new suite of sensors, it has significantly enhanced the boat’s situational awareness and precision. That expertise now places the team among the front-runners of the AI Class.

The boat

UANTWERP SOLAR BOAT TEAM

The project’s main innovations focus on autonomy, perception and performance. A complete overhaul of the navigation and perception architecture led to a fully custom, ROS2-based navigation stack, designed specifically for high-precision autonomous sailing in dynamic, competitive environments. In parallel, the team introduced a 360-degree stereovision, AI-driven perception system that significantly enhances environmental awareness. By combining advanced computer vision with real-time sensor fusion, the boat can accurately detect obstacles, recognise course elements and respond intelligently during autonomous manoeuvres. Redesigns to the boat’s structure and driveline further improved peak performance, efficiency and reliability, ensuring the platform fully supports the increased demands of high-speed, autonomous operation.

Follow the team at the Challenge

UAntwerp Solar Boat Team competes in the AI Class at the 13th Monaco Energy Boat Challenge, 7–11 July 2026 in Port Hercule. The University of Antwerp team brings a solar racing boat built for high-precision autonomy, with a custom ROS2 navigation stack, a 360-degree stereovision AI perception system and real-time sensor fusion for intelligent obstacle detection and manoeuvring.
